BIM CPD in June and July

Getting Started with BIM: Have you been seriously considering implementing BIM within your organisation and are now asking ‘What do we do next’? This seminar covers the preparation and planning required by architectural or engineering personnel who want to make implementation happen. It provides generic guidance on the topic and discusses some of the decisions to be made and issues which need to be considered.

The NATSPEC BIM Protocol: This seminar is directed at clients and lead consultants on projects using BIM who want to avoid the cost of delays and re-works caused by poor definition of BIM requirements prior to calling for expressions of interest from consultants.  It explains how the Protocol can be used to clarify and describe the level of BIM implementation at the project’s outset, and how NATSPEC BIM documents can assist.

Review of National BIM Guide

NATSPEC is updating the National BIM Guide. Please help!

Collaborate Working Group CWG‑002 has just released a report which focuses on reviewing the National BIM Guide and BIM Management Plan template. Its goal was to provide NATSPEC with industry feedback on its suite of documents based on “real world use”. NATSPEC thanks CWG-002 for the significant effort they put into their report.

What’s happening in Australia?

NATSPEC has compiled details of BIM research and development projects being undertaken by Australian Government and industry organisations. The project details provide a resource for everyone involved with, or interested in, BIM R & D. The aim is to facilitate collaboration and avoid duplication of effort. This work was completed on behalf of the Australasian Procurement and Construction Council (APCC) and Australian Construction Industry Forum (ACIF).
